One big advantage of using Tourmobile is that they are the only ones that can travel within Arlington National Cemetary. However one can purchase a ticket from Tourmobile at a reduced price for travel ONLY within Arlington.

Tourmobile's disadvantage is that they operate pretty much only within the immediate area of the National Mall. No trips to Dupont Circle, National Cathedral, etc.

Tourmobile is $20 a day or $30 for two days, while Old Town Trolly is $32 a day. As mentioned, tourmobile doesn't go as far away from downtown and mall area. The hours are 9:30-4pm which isn't very long when you are going on capital tours, or smithsonians. Several times, time was up before we could get back to a metro station or our next stop. A couple of the museums are open to 6:30 or 7:30 in summer but we had to walk to them. Still nice way to take a tour of area, and to get out to Arlington. The cemetary tour is included with the all day pass.
